Agrégée is the feminine form of agrégé, a title given in France to individuals who have passed the agrégation, a national competitive examination for recruitment to the highest ranks of the public education system. The exam remains one of the most prestigious qualifications for teachers in France, traditionally associated with senior positions in lycées and in certain higher-education teaching tracks.
